The word "starknesses" may not be commonly used in everyday language, but there are several synonyms that can be used in its place. "Austere" and "bareness" both convey a sense of simplicity and lack of adornment. "Simplicity" and "plainness" both suggest a lack of complexity or detailed decoration. "Severity" and "harshness" communicate a sense of harshness or demandingness. "Barrenness" and "emptiness" suggest a lack of substance or vitality. These synonyms can be used in a variety of contexts, from describing the landscape of a barren desert to the simplicity of a minimalist design.
